Output 679358301c84d4b4aaa25680fb39e4e6f87c1cf144d5fb1d61decf05aabfa4a4:0

value
26449896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bfa27e19bbe836fb748e5c36830cdeb15a778fa OP_EQUAL
address
3FukLQWk5ktc84noKpVePpxMK5xyPFmZpb
transaction
679358301c84d4b4aaa25680fb39e4e6f87c1cf144d5fb1d61decf05aabfa4a4
confirmations
101416
spent
true